Unstuffed 'stuffed' Cabbage

Servings: 8
This recipe came out of the paper. I haven't tried it yet, but it does seem to have all of the elements of real German comfort food! (Serving time and prep time are approximate)
Ingredients:
1 lb ground beef
2 eggs
1 cup cooked rice
1 tablespoon sugar
1 dash cinnamon
1 dash allspice
salt and pepper, to taste
1 medium chopped onion
2 (8 ounce) cans tomato sauce
water
1 (14 1/2 ounce) can sauerkraut
3 tablespoons brown sugar
3/4 cup raisins
1 small cabbage
Directions:
1. MEATBALLS:.
2. Mix ground beef with eggs, rice and 1 tablespoon sugar; season with cinnamon, allspice, salt and pepper.
3. Form into balls.
4. SAUCE:.
5. Saute chopped onion in oil until golden.
6. Add tomato sauce, 1 can of water, sauerkraut with its juice, brown sugar and raisins.
7. Heat this mixture and taste- it should be sweet and sour.
8. CASSEROLE:.
9. Shred cabbage, or cut into thin strips (eliminate any hard, veined parts).
10. Pour some of sauce on bottom of roasting pan.
11. Layer half of shredded cabbage over sauce.
12. Place meat balls on top of cabbage.
13. Cover with remaining cabbage, and pour on remaining sauce.
14. Cover pan with lid or foil.
15. Bake at 325 degrees for 1 1/2 hours.
16. Lower heat to 275 degrees and bake for another hour.
